Oil extended gains on Tuesday, lifted by hopes of improved economic activity after the US-EU trade deal, a potential US-China tariff truce and President Donald Trump's shorter deadline for Russia to end the Ukraine war. Brent crude rose 24 cents (0.34%) to $70.28 a barrel, while WTI gained 22 cents (0.33%) to $66.93 by 0000 GMT.
